摘 要:在棉花种质资源研究中,性状的变异大多在成株期以后才能发现和鉴别,往往需要移栽保存,并减少叶、蕾、铃等器官损伤。但是棉花为直根系农作物,根系再生能力较差,现蕾后的成株移栽大多无法成活。安徽省农业科学院棉花研究所棉花种质资源及育种项目组经过多年探索,成功研发出一种棉花成株期无损伤移栽技术,为棉花种质资源的保存和利用提供了一种新途径,实际应用效果良好,值得在棉花种质资源研究中借鉴和应用。In the research of cotton germplasm resources,variations of traits are generally discovered and identified after the adult stage,which often requires transplanting and preservation,and reduce the damage of leaves,buds,bolls and other organs.But cotton is a taproot crop with poor root regeneration ability.After cotton buds in the adult stage,most of its transplanting cannot survive.Therefore,after years of exploration,the cotton germplasm resources and breeding project team of the cotton research institute of the Anhui academy of agricultural sciences has successfully developed a non-damaged transplanting technology for cotton at the adult stage.It provides a new way for the conservation and utilization of cotton germplasm resources,and the practical application effect is good.It is worthy of reference and application in cotton germplasm resources research.
